Lahiru Ranika was judged this years of the Junior National Open Championships 2014. Playing steady gold right through and totaling a score of 244 (81+83+80), Lamindu won by eleven strokes over Runner-up H.

Prashan Lakshitha who carded an eighty seven in the final round totaling two hundred and fifty five. 

Sathsara Dilshan with an eighty one final round totaling two hundred and thirty nine for the three rounds won the silver division and showed potential as a name to be reckoned with in the future golfing franchise in Sri Lanka. He won 12 strokes ahead of young and up-coming Taniya Minel who recently came third in the Junior Golf Event in held in India. She too will be a name to watch out for in the years to come.

Prima Sunrise the main sponsor has supported this event over the last seven years and the Sri Lanka Golf Union is helpful of reaching out to more youngster to take up this game which is today considered as the fastest growing sports especially in Asia.
